Unlocking Hair Growth Potential- The Surprising Benefits of Fermented Rice Water for Your Locks

Is fermented rice water good for hair growth? This question has intrigued many individuals looking for natural remedies to enhance their hair health. Fermented rice water, an ancient practice from traditional Chinese medicine, has gained popularity in recent years as a potential solution for promoting hair growth and improving overall hair quality.

Fermented rice water is created by soaking rice in water and allowing it to ferment over time. This process results in a nutrient-rich liquid that contains a variety of beneficial components for hair growth. The primary ingredients responsible for its hair-enhancing properties include amino acids, v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ants.

Amino acids are essential for hair growth as they contribute to the production of keratin, a protein that forms the structural foundation of hair. Fermented rice water contains a variety of amino acids, such as lysine and arginine, which can help stimulate hair follicle activity and encourage new hair growth.

Vitamins and minerals are crucial for maintaining healthy hair, and fermented rice water is rich in these nutrients. For instance, vitamin E, found in abundance in fermented rice water, has been shown to protect hair follicles from oxidative stress and improve blood circulation to the scalp. This, in turn, can enhance hair growth and prevent hair loss.

Antioxidants play a significant role in protecting hair from environmental damage and free radicals. Fermented rice water is a source of antioxidants like ferulic acid and phytic acid, which can help combat hair damage and promote a healthier scalp environment.

To incorporate fermented rice water into your hair care routine, simply soak a handful of rice in water for several hours or overnight. Once the rice has absorbed the water and fermented, strain the liquid and use it as a hair rinse or mix it with other natural ingredients like coconut oil or honey to create a hair mask. Regularly applying fermented rice water can help improve hair texture, reduce frizz, and promote hair growth over time.
